How they compare

Tunisia currently reports 1.82 against 1.8 in Georgia, a difference of 0.02.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 65 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Tunisia ahead.

Georgia ranks 118th and Tunisia ranks 115th of 215 countries.

Across the 7 decades both report, Georgia averaged higher in 1 and Tunisia in 6.

Head to head by decade

Decade Georgia Tunisia Difference Ahead
1960s 2.83 7.04 4.21 Tunisia
1970s 2.56 5.92 3.36 Tunisia
1980s 2.34 4.48 2.13 Tunisia
1990s 1.89 2.76 0.8701 Tunisia
2000s 1.66 1.97 0.3089 Tunisia
2010s 2.07 2.22 0.1504 Tunisia
2020s 1.88 1.86 0.0182 Georgia

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
